Want to join the Three Rivers Bass Association?

Here are the facts you need to know about all of the registration details.

pennsylvania-tbf-flw-logoThe Three Rivers Bass Association (TRBA) is a bass fishing club for both competitive anglers, and recreational anglers alike.  The TRBA is a club registered with the The Bass Federation (bassfederation.com), which is associated with the FLW (flwoutdoors.com).  Membership in both of these organizations is required to be an angler in the Three Rivers Bass Association.  In addition, all of the Bass Federation (TBF) clubs fishing out of Pennsylvania, must register with the state (pabass.com), along with the anglers on it's roster.  PA Bass was originally incorporated in 1972 as the Pennsylvania BASS Chapter Federation Inc.

PA Bass is the original, largest and premier bass organization in the state.

Costs:

The FLW membership at the competitor level is required.  Current cost is $25 for TBF Members.

TBF & PA Bass fees are currently $55 combined ($15 TBF, $40 PA Bass).

TRBA Member Dues are $20 annual.  (This fee is currently waived for boat owners and anglers registering through December 31, 2009)

 

trba weblogosmallThe Rundown:

FLW $25

TBF/PA $55

TRBA $20 =

Total $100 - That's Less than $8.34 a month!!
